Description: Define the set of positive reals. Definition of positive numbers in [Apostol] p. 20. (Contributed by NM, 27-Oct-2007.) |
Ref | Expression |
---|---|
df-rp | ⊢ ℝ+ = {𝑥 ∈ ℝ ∣ 0 < 𝑥} |
